Dec 17, 2024

Routine

Score: 87Grade: B5 violations
Comments

Questions? www.gnrhealth.com or 770.963.5132 Note: All cold holding temperatures are in compliance unless noted otherwise. Note: Ensure beverages are stored off the floor. Note: An informal follow up will occur 12/20/2024 to ensure beard hair restraints are provided for employees. Failure to correct by 12/20/2024 may result in permit suspension

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

2-2E: .03(6)Person in charge unable to correctly inform inspector of the vomit/bodily fluid clean up procedure. A food establishment shall have procedures for employees to follow when responding to vomiting or diarrheal events that involve the discharge of vomitus or fecal matter onto surfaces in the food service establishment. The procedures shall address the specific actions employees must take to minimize the spread of contamination and the exposure of employees, consumers, food, and surfaces to vomitus or fecal matter. (Pf) Corrective Actions: Bleach onsite. PIC informed about the correct procedure to reflect items located onsite. Procedures located inside DPH binder.

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

8-2B: .07(6)(c)Equipment cleaned and glass cleaned bottles stored with flour under prep table. Poisonous or toxic materials shall be stored and displayed for retail sale so they cannot contaminate food, equipment, utensils, linens, and single-service and single-use articles. (P) Corrective Actions: Person in charge relocated chemicals to designated area.

-

Corrected: NoRepeat: No

12B: .03(5)(i)Food handler missing beard guard during food prep. Correct by 12/20/2024 Employees preparing or handling food shall use effective and clean, disposable or easily cleanable nets or other hair restraints approved by the Health Authority, worn properly to restrain loose hair including beards and mustaches longer than one half inch (1/2"). (C)

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

13A: .02(1)(d)Copy of latest inspection score not posted. Inspection from 2023 currently posted. The most current inspection report shall be prominently displayed in public view at all times, within fifteen feet of the front or primary public door and between five feet and seven feet from the floor and in an area where it can be read at a distance of one foot away. (C) Corrective Actions: Person in charge (Pic) emailed copy of the latest inspection score.

-

Corrected: YesRepeat: No

17D: .07(4)(b)Employee phone stored on prep top table next to 3 compartment sink. Lockers or other suitable facilities shall be provided and used for the orderly storage of employees' clothing and other possessions. (C) Corrective Actions: PIC removed phone and stored in designated employee area.
